Helicopter crashes in a field with two people on board

A helicopter has crashed in a field with two people on board.

Emergency services were sent to the scene in Herefordshire after the incident happened at around 3pm today, Friday, April 2.

Police and ambulance crews are in attendance in a field off Bromyard Road in Ledbury, Birmingham Live reports.

The location of the incident is around 12 miles outside Hereford and 14 miles outside Worcester.

West Mercia Police said in a statement: "Around 3pm this afternoon (Friday 2 April) we were informed a helicopter had crashed in a field off Bromyard Road in Ledbury, Herefordshire.

"Emergency services are currently at the scene.

"Two people were on board the helicopter and while the extent of injuries is not yet known, they are not believed to be serious."

According to the Malvern Gazette, police have received a number of calls from members of the public about the incident.

Details about the type of helicopter involved or what might have caused the incident are not yet known.
